About This Course
Quantum computing is redefining the computational limits of science, opening new avenues for environmental modeling, climate simulation, and resource optimization. This 4-week DeepTech e-learning program delves into the application of quantum algorithms for solving high-complexity problems in environmental systems.
Participants will explore quantum principles, including qubits, superposition, and entanglement, while learning to apply quantum theory to model intricate environmental processes like climate dynamics, ecosystem behavior, and pollution forecasting. The course also addresses computational ethics, the sustainability of quantum solutions, and emerging research directions in quantum-enabled environmental science.
